I came across descriptions of Pasupata-Sutra one of the seminal texts of Lakulisa-Pasupata order,attributed to Lakulisa, in various books on Saivism and I was baffled to read about the curious ritual practices (vidhi) suggested for the ascetic aspirant of the order. There seemed to be a total disconnect between the highly evolved philosophy and such apparently absurd looking ritual practices viz....
